Quiz Answer Key and Fun Facts
1. Did Jacob have any daughters that we know about?

Answer: Yes

Jacob's eleventh child was a daughter born to him by his wife Leah and her name was Dinah. This can be found in Genesis 30. Dinah was the only recorded daughter of Jacob.
2. How many children did Jacob have?

Answer: 13

Reuben, Simeon, Levi, Judah, Dan, Naphtali, Gad, Asher, Issachar, Zebulun, daughter Dinah, Joseph, and Benjamin are his children. His children with Leah: Reuben the firstborn of Jacob, Simeon, Levi, Judah, Issachar, Zebulun and Dinah. His children with Leah's servant, Zilpah: Gad and Asher.

His children with Rachel: Joseph and Benjamin. His children with Rachel's servant, Bilhah: Dan and Naphtali.

4. Who wrote the eleventh book of the New Testament?

Answer: Paul

The eleventh book of the New Testament is the letter to the Philippians. It was written by Paul and was addressed to the church in Philippi. Philippians is the fiftieth book of the Bible and contains only four chapters.
5. King Darius, who was king of Babylon during the time of Daniel, was of what nationality?

Answer: Mede

The day before Darius became king King Belshazzar threw a party and during the party an angel wrote on the wall "Mene Mene Tekel Parsin" which translates to "God has numbered the days of your reign and brought it to an end. You have been weighed on the scales and found wanting. Your kingdom is divided and given to the Medes and Persians." Darius was the Mede and Cyrus, who helped the Israelites come out of exile, was the Persian.

7. How many of Nebuchadnezzar's dreams did Daniel interpret?

Answer: 2

The first one can be found in Daniel 2 and the second one can be found in Daniel 4. The first one's interpretation was about the kingdoms to come. The second one's interpretation was that Nebuchadnezzar's kingdom was to be taken away from him and, twelve months later, it happened.
8. Finish the NIV verse. "So I say, live by the Spirit, and you will not gratify the desires of the..." what?

Answer: Sinful nature

Galatians 5:16 is where this verse can be found. Also found in Galatians 5 are the fruit of the Spirit which are "Love, joy, peace, patience, kindness, goodness, faithfulness, gentleness and self-control. Against such things there is no law." -Galatians 5:22-23.
9. How many books of the Bible only have one chapter?

Answer: 5

Obadiah, Philemon, 2 John, 3 John and Jude are the five with only one chapter. 2 John is the shortest with 13 verses then comes 3 John with 14 verses then Obadiah with 21 verses and Philemon and Jude are tied with 25 verses each.
10. In Jeremiah 32 God tells Jeremiah to buy a field that was going to be offered to him. Who was he to buy it from?

Answer: Hanamel

Hanamel son of Shallum, Jeremiah's cousin, came to Jeremiah and told him to buy a field from him because as nearest relative it was his right and duty to possess it. The field was located in Anathoth in the territory of Benjamin and Jeremiah bought it for 17 shekels of silver. 17 shekels is about 7 ounces, 200 grams.
